The ‘Korean Glass Skin’ trend has captivated beauty lovers worldwide, and for good reason. This radiant, dewy complexion gives off an effortlessly flawless glow that appears almost translucent. While skincare is the foundation of achieving glass skin, makeup can take it to the next level by enhancing luminosity while providing a bit more coverage.

Step 1: Prep with a Hydrating Mask

Great makeup starts with great skin, and hydration is key. Before applying any makeup, I always use a hydrating mask to plump and refresh my complexion. One of my current favorites is a dry sheet mask that delivers deep moisture without the mess of a traditional sheet mask. In just 15 minutes, my skin feels rejuvenated, radiant, and perfectly primed for the next steps.

Step 2: Moisturize, Moisturize, Moisturize!

To lock in hydration and create a smooth base, applying a lightweight yet deeply nourishing moisturizer is essential. Professional makeup artists always emphasize the importance of prepping the skin, and I’ve adopted the same habit. A rich yet non-greasy moisturizer ensures that foundation and other products blend seamlessly while maintaining a fresh glow.

Step 3: The Secret Weapon – Illuminating Primer

This is my ultimate glass skin hack! An illuminating primer or glow-enhancing product is a game-changer. Think of it as a real-life version of your favorite beauty filter—smoothing, brightening, and giving your skin a radiant boost. It’s slightly tinted but isn’t meant for coverage; instead, it enhances the natural luminosity of your skin. You can wear it alone for a subtle glow, mix it with your foundation, or even dab it on top for extra sheen.

Step 4: Lightweight Foundation & Concealer

When aiming for a glass skin effect, less is more. A lightweight, luminous foundation evens out the complexion without looking heavy or cakey. I opt for a silky, medium-coverage formula that provides a natural finish while enhancing radiance. To conceal any blemishes or redness, I use a creamy, blendable concealer that melts into the skin seamlessly.

Step 5: Setting Powder – Just the Right Amount

While the goal is a glowing complexion, you don’t want to look overly shiny. Lightly dusting a finishing powder on the T-zone and any oil-prone areas keeps the look polished yet fresh. A finely milled, translucent setting powder works best to blur imperfections while maintaining that signature glass-like effect.

Step 6: Dewy Highlighter for the Ultimate Glow

A traditional powder highlighter can sometimes appear too shimmery for the glass skin look, which is why I love using a moisturizing oil-based highlighter instead. It gives a naturally radiant sheen rather than a glittery finish, enhancing the dewy effect without overwhelming the complexion. Dabbing a bit on the high points of the face—cheekbones, bridge of the nose, and cupid’s bow—adds just the right amount of luminosity.

Step 7: Lock It In with a Face Mist

To bring everything together and keep the skin looking fresh all day, I finish with a hydrating setting mist. This step not only helps set makeup but also enhances the glow, ensuring that the skin looks radiant and plump throughout the day.
